    You will be picked up from your hotel in the morning and driven to Chanderi that is at a distance of 70 miles from Orchha. The history of this town can be traced back from the early Vedic period to several later kingdoms - the Delhi Sultanate in the 13th century, the Tughlaq dynasty and the Mughals in the 16th century. You will visit the 15th century ruins of Koshak Mahal, built entirely out of white sandstone. Your guide will tell you the tragic tale of the legendary Kati Ghati Gateway. Drive to the Khandagiri Jain temples, which were cut out of stone around 700 years ago. The major highlight of this set of temples is a gigantic 45 feet statue of the first Jain Tirthankara, Rishabnath that is carved on the surface of a hillock. Apart from its historic monuments, Chanderi is also famous for its hand-woven Chanderi sarees. Enjoy a home-cooked vegetarian picnic lunch.
